Indian time / La Boîte Rouge vif presents ; a film by Carl Morasse.
Captured over a period of five years within 18 communities, Indian Time is a personal and current portrayal of the 11 Aboriginal nations of Québec, where some forty people take turns speaking, allowing for exceptional encounters and immersing the viewer in this "Indian Time."
